Vegetable Ramen Noodle is a popular dish found in many restaurants in the USA. It's a flavorful and healthy option for vegetarians and vegans.

Ingredients:

  • Noodles
    Typically made from wheat flour and vegetable starch, providing a chewy and slightly elastic texture.
  • Broth
    A base of vegetables, such as onions, carrots, mushrooms, ginger, garlic, and spices, simmered for hours to create a rich and flavorful broth.
  • Vegetables
    A variety of colorful vegetables are added to the broth, such as:
  • * Broccoli florets

    * Carrots, sliced

    * Mushrooms, sliced

    * Bean sprouts

    * Tofu, cut into cubes

    * Spinach

  • Toppings
    Common toppings include:
  • * Fried garlic toast

    * Soft boiled egg

    * Avocado slices

    * Sesame seeds

    * Green onions

    Flavor and Texture:

  • The dish offers a delightful combination of textures and flavors.
  • The broth is typically light and savory, with a hint of umami from the vegetables.
  • The noodles are chewy and slightly elastic, holding their shape well in the broth.
  • The vegetables add bursts of fresh and crunchy flavors, while the toppings provide additional textures and flavors.
  • Variations:

  • Spicy Vegetable Ramen Noodle
    Adds chili oil or pepper flakes for a spicy kick.
  • Kimchi Vegetable Ramen Noodle
    Features kimchi, a fermented cabbage dish, for a tangy and spicy flavor.
  • Vegan Vegetable Ramen Noodle
    Uses plant-based broth and toppings to cater to dietary preferences.
